A Black & Gold Graduation Card

Last Friday we attended our middle granddaughter's high school graduation. What a fabulous time we had with so many family members!  I did make her a special card using her school colors, black and gold.


I seen a fellow coach's card and it so inspired me to make this one.  Didn't it turn out great!

Stamp Set: Bravo Grad
Dies: Hats Off and Star Burst Bloom
Inks: Gold and Black Licorice
Card stocks: Black Licorice, Whip Cream, and Brushed Gold
Washi Tape: Licorice Sparkle and a retired one but the Simply Gold would work wonderfully!
Accessories: Fashion Gold dots
Tools and Adhesives: The Platinum, Paper Trimmer, Foam Squares, Easy Glide Runner, Glue Dots,
Details Pro Shears

I searched the web for a sentiment for the inside which I used a word program and printed.
